The use of cytogenetic microarrays in myelodysplastic syndrome characterization.
Methods in molecular biology (Clifton, N.J.) - 1 Jan 2013
Shaffer Lisa G, Ballif Blake C, Schultz Roger A
Abstract excerpt
Various microarray platforms, including BAC, oligonucleotide, and SNP arrays, have been shown to -provide clinically useful diagnostic and prognostic information for patients with myelodysplastic syndromes (MDS). Clinically useful arrays are designed with specific purposes in mind and with attention to genomic content and probe density. All array types have been shown to detect genomic copy gains and losses, with...
